APPLICATION

This 600V portable welding machine cable is specifically designed for arc welding systems, serving as a high-quality welding lead to connect the electrode holder to the welding machine, suitable for the welding secondary circuit. Its outstanding flexibility makes it easy to operate in various welding environments, making it an ideal choice for professional welders and industrial users. It is widely used in industries such as shipbuilding, construction engineering, metal fabrication, and automotive repair, meeting the diverse needs of different sectors for efficient and safe welding.

STANDARDS

  • ICEA S-75-381/NEMA WC 58

  • ASTM B 172

  • ASTM B 33

  • CAN/CSA C22.2 No. 96

  • UL 1581

CONSTRUCTION

ConductorsClass K/M stranded annealed copper conductor.
JacketHeavy-duty/medium-duty Ethylene Propylene Rubber (EPR).

OPTIONS

Other jacket materials such as CSP/PCP/NBR/PVC are available upon request.
Two-layer jacket with reinforcing fibre between the two layers can be offered as an option.

MECHANICAL AND THERMAL PROPERTIES

Minimum Bending Radius6×OD
Maximum Conductor Operating Temperature+90℃
